About this listen
Lange bevor der Spiegel Autorenzeilen unter den Artikeln einführte, erkannte man die Beiträge des Heimweh-Iren und Kopfweh-Briten Glass. In ihrer stilistischen Originalität und ihrem Einfallsreichtum sind sie unerreicht und genießen Kultstatus. Die vorliegende Sammlung feiert den findigen Kopf und stellt einige seiner besten Texte vor.
